| Sumario: | Molecular properties of Neurospora soluble protein kinase and cyclic AMP binding activities have been determined. Cyclic AMP-dependent Peak I kinase activity with a molecular weight of 118 000 is composed of two subunits, catalytic and regulatory, having molecular weights of 55 000 and 57 000, respectively. Cyclic AMP-independent Peak II kinase activity has a molecular weight of 56 000. Cyclic AMP-independent Peak III kinase has a molecular weight of 209 000. © 1982 Martinus Nijhoff/Dr W.
